Маски прозрачности в GIMP

Маски прозрачности — специальные средства, позволяющие задать степень прозрачности отдельных регионов изображения на конкретном слое. Выше мы рассматривали такой параметр слоя, как его непрозрачность, и, оперируя им, делали более или менее прозрачным весь слой равномерно. При помощи масок прозрачности можно сделать одни регионы слоя совершенно прозрачными, другие — полупрозрачными, третьи — непрозрачными вовсе.

Маски прозрачности широко применяются при монтаже изображений, а также для создания классического эффекта «перехода» одного изображения в другое. Прежде всего рассмотрим общий порядок работы с масками прозрачности в GIMP 2.

В выпадающем меню Файл выберите пункт Открыть как слои. В появившемся окне Открыть изображение укажите два файла, содержащие какие-либо клипарты или фотографии: главное, чтобы это были красочные, полноцветные изображения, желательно одного размера. Оба изображения откроются в GIMP в одном файле и будут помещены на два разных слоя. Таким образом, у нас получилось совмещенное изображение, но изображение верхнего слоя перекрыло изображение нижнего.

Нажмите правую кнопку мыши по верхнему слою на панели Слои для вызова меню. Выберите здесь пункт Добавить маску слоя.

В появившемся окне можно сразу же задать содержимое маски.

Окно Добавить маску слоя

Оставьте здесь вариант Белый цвет (полная непрозрачность) и нажмите кнопку Добавить. Обратите внимание, что на панели Слои на значке с верхним слоем добавился значок маски прозрачности.

Маска прозрачности как бы накладывается сверху на изображение конкретного слоя и задает его прозрачные и полупрозрачные регионы. Там, где маска белая, регион будет совершенно непрозрачным, там, где маска черная, — совершенно прозрачным, если цвет маски серый — то полупрозрачным и т. д.

Таким образом, рисуя по маске, мы задаем степень прозрачности отдельных регионов. Мы не зря открыли два изображения и поместили их на разные слои. Дело в том, что, задавая прозрачность верхнему слою, мы будем видеть сквозь него содержимое нижнего слоя, а иначе видели бы пустое изображение, что смазало бы эффект.

Сразу после создания маски прозрачности мы автоматически переходим в режим ее редактирования. Это означает, что действие всех известных нам инструментов распространяется не на само изображение слоя, а на маску его прозрачности.

Возьмите инструмент Кисть. Немного увеличьте значение ее параметра Масштаб, чтобы сделать штрих крупнее. Выберите цвет кисти — черный. Нанесите несколько штрихов (при этом следите, чтобы на панели слоев был выделен тот слой, для которого была создана маска прозрачности). Вместо того чтобы рисовать черным цветом, кисть, редактируя маску прозрачности, делает отдельные регионы изображения полностью прозрачными. Мы как будто прорезаем проемы в изображении слоя с помощью кисти.

Теперь сделайте цвет кисти не черным, а серым. После этого, применяя кисть, мы будем делать отдельные регионы изображения полупрозрачными, а не полностью прозрачными. Если выбрать светло-серый цвет кисти, то прозрачность будет едва заметной, если темно-серый — прозрачность усилится и т. д. В то же время все накладываемые на маску прозрачности штрихи отображаются на уменьшенном варианте, представленном на значке с соответствующим слоем на панели Слои.

Для возврата в режим редактирования содержимого слоя, а не маски прозрачности щелкните правой кнопкой мыши по значку со слоем для вызова меню и выберите в нем пункт Изменить маску слоя.

Галочка будет убрана, и теперь вы, как и раньше, будете рисовать по слою, но с учетом уже созданных изменений прозрачности.

Чтобы вернуться в режим редактирования маски прозрачности, необходимо снова установить данную галочку. Для отображения маски прозрачности непосредственно на самом изображении необходимо выбрать в данном меню пункт Показать маску слоя. Для отмены отображения необходимо убрать галочку рядом с этим пунктом.

Пункт меню Спрятать маску слоя позволяет временно отключить действие маски прозрачности.

Если отображение маски при этом отключено, то она никаким образом не будет влиять на изображение.

Если вы полностью закончили работать над маской прозрачности и не планируете в дальнейшем продолжать ее редактирование, имеет смысл использовать опцию Применить маску слоя, расположенную в том же меню.

В таком случае маска будет применена, т. е. ее действие не пропадет, но сама она будет удалена из текущего слоя.

Таким образом, с помощью масок прозрачности можно произвольно настраивать прозрачность отдельных регионов изображения, а не всего слоя целиком.

Рассмотрим классический прием совмещения двух изображений с помощью маски слоя. Суть его заключается в плавном переходе одного изображения в другое. Воспользуемся иллюстрациями, представленными на рисункеt ниже.

Исходные изображения

Вы можете использовать подобные изображения или любые другие, совершенно необязательно перекликающиеся.

Откройте оба изображения в одном файле с помощью опции Открыть как слои выпадающего меню Файл. Оба изображения откроются и будут помещены на отдельные слои.

Выделите верхний слой, вызовите его меню правой кнопкой мыши и выберите в нем пункт Добавить маску слоя. В окне Добавить маску слоя оставьте вариант Белый цвет (полная непрозрачность) и нажмите кнопку Добавить. Появляется маска прозрачности, готовая к редактированию.

Выберите инструмент Градиент. Используя стандартные черно-белые цвета градиента, нарисуйте небольшой отрезок в центре изображения. В результате черно-белый градиент будет применен к маске прозрачности, что приведет к плавному совмещению двух изображений, плавному переходу одного изображения в другое.

Результат применения маски прозрачности

По окончании создания маски прозрачности можно использовать опцию Применить маску слоя.

  • Создание фотоколлажа в GIMP
  • Применение стилей слоев
  • Фотомонтаж двух и более изображений. Маски слоя
  • Создание макетных групп
  • Преобразование слоев и выделенных областей
  • Комментариев пока нет. Будете первым?

    Оставить комментарий

    XHTML: Вы можете использовать эти теги: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>